Since ancient times, papaya has been loved by countless poets, who have written many popular poems on papaya. There is a line in "The Book of Songs·Wei Feng·Papaya" that says "Throw me a papaya, and I will repay you with a jade pendant". Cao Rong of the Qing Dynasty also wrote a poem "Nanpu·Papaya": "The courtyard is full of fragrance, and it is good to transplant the green porcelain and sycamore trees into two wells. I still remember the stamens when they were first contained, the traces of makeup were light, and they were delicate and quiet like pear trees. When I was rubbing my forehead, I felt the coldness of my light clothes. The fairy dew formed a ball, and the autumn color was playing, and the green was getting harder to determine. I picked it and took it back to the Pearl Pavilion to snuggle up, but the gentleness did not change, it was the nature of the flower. Who can bear the fragrance? In the Luopa, I bought a jade plate and reflected it high. I woke up from a deep sleep, and my slender hands and fragrance condensed at night. Tomorrow, I will tease the spring love, and I will also cure people's sorrow."

variety

There are several main varieties of papaya:

Wrinkled papaya, also known as crabapple with stems, papaya with stems, and iron-footed pear. The fruit peel is slightly wrinkled 7 to 10 days after ripening, hence the name wrinkled papaya. The fruit can be made into a variety of foods such as candied fruit, jam, and juice. The dried fruit is used for medicinal purposes. Wrinkled papaya is a mainstream product of Chinese medicinal papaya.

Papaya with smooth skin is also known as papaya crabapple, dragon-subduing wood, Fengshui tree, cantaloupe, papaya, hawthorn, wood plum, and wood pear. It is a deciduous shrub or small tree. Papaya with smooth skin is mainly for viewing. You can enjoy the flowers in early summer and the fruits in autumn. It is also very beautiful when it turns red at night in late autumn. After 5 to 8 years, the seedlings will enter the flowering and fruiting period. The medicinal effect of papaya with smooth skin is very small. Because its fruit is still smooth and not wrinkled after drying, it is called papaya with smooth skin.

Papaya, also known as wood peach, is native to southwest China. It is a deciduous shrub to small tree, with ovoid or nearly cylindrical fruits that can be used as medicine but are not edible.
